(Aurora, Ind.) - The City of Aurora is once again offering a Not-for-Profit Grant Opportunity. Nonprofit organizations with projects that will directly benefit the residents of Aurora are encouraged to apply.

A letter of request should be directed to the Aurora City Manager and include, but not limited to, organization name, 501(c)(3) identification number, contact name, contact address and phone as well as detailed specifies of the request including amount requested. Applications will be accepted until 4:00 PM, Friday, March 29 by email, mail or hand delivery.

The Not-for-Profit Grant Program is administered and awarded by the City of Aurora. A committee will meet to review applications, and make award recommendations to Aurora City Council on Monday, April 8 at 7:00 PM.

For further information on the City of Aurora Not-for-Profit Grant Opportunity, please contact Aurora City Manager Austin Woods with questions at awoods@aurora.in.us
